Tracing the relationship between morphological and chromosomal evolution in Nannospalax sp. using three-dimensional geometric morphometrics

Using three-dimensional geometric morphometrics to examine how chromosomal divergence relates to morphological evolution in blind mole rats.

Anatolian blind mole rats (Nannospalax) comprise numerous cytotypes that differ in chromosome number and structure. This project asks whether chromosomal divergence among cytotypes is paralleled by morphological change.

Landmark-based shape analyses on three-dimensional digital models of specimens are used to compare morphological and chromosomal evolution. The project is carried out within TÜBİTAK’s bilateral cooperation programme with Serbia.
